EAST PRAIRIE - James Byron "J.B." Benson, 94, died Nov. 19, 2005, at his home.
Born Oct. 30, 1911, in Hickman, Ky., son of the late James Crosby and Buelah Kelly Benson, he was a retired Massey-Ferguson farm equipment dealer and a Missouri Century Farm farmer. He was a talented woodworker and enjoyed cooking wild game.
On Nov. 20, 1937, he married Goldia Beck, who preceded him in death on Jan. 13, 1994.
Two sisters and two brothers also preceded him in death.
